摘要: 给出了一种适合二维三温辐射流体力学能量方程的大型稀疏线性代数方程组的混合迭代算法.计算结果显示,该算法解二维三温辐射流体力学能量方程的大型稀疏线性代数方程组比原有算法快4倍左右;原有算法不收敛时,该算法收敛;各物理量也符合得很好.
关键词: 二维三温能量方程, 混合算法
Abstract: A new type of hybrid iterative method is presented, which is competent in solving the large scale sparse linear systems derived from the 2-dimensional 3-temperature radiation dynamic energy equations. Numerical results show that the new method is as 4 times fast as the old ones.Especially on the cases the old one doesn't converge, the new method can easily get the solution to the precision required. It can successfully complete the simulation and the final physical parameters of the simulation coincide with the theory.
Key words: two-dimensional three-temperature energy equations, hybrid method
